Homa Javahery is a scholar working on Human-Computer Interaction, Information Systems and Molecular Biology. According to data from OpenAlex, Homa Javahery has authored 9 papers receiving a total of 90 indexed citations (citations by other indexed papers that have themselves been cited), including 4 papers in Human-Computer Interaction, 2 papers in Information Systems and 1 paper in Molecular Biology. Recurrent topics in Homa Javahery's work include Usability and User Interface Design (4 papers), Persona Design and Applications (2 papers) and Innovative Human-Technology Interaction (2 papers). Homa Javahery is often cited by papers focused on Usability and User Interface Design (4 papers), Persona Design and Applications (2 papers) and Innovative Human-Technology Interaction (2 papers). Homa Javahery collaborates with scholars based in Canada, Germany and France. Homa Javahery's co-authors include Ahmed Seffah, Ahmed Seffah, Peter Forbrig, Rex B. Kline, Juergen Rilling, T. Radhakrishnan and Ashraf Gaffar and has published in prestigious journals such as Communications of the ACM, Journal of the Association for Information Systems and Journal of Systems and Software.
